A vital member of the NL team, Mrs Beron leads the immigration and civil procedures services team. Her educational background includes a degree in law at Universidad Libre de Colombia in 1987; Mrs Beron furthered her education in the UK and completed a MBA in refugee studies at East London University in 2001. Mrs Beron, worked for prestigious law organisations in Colombia for several years until moving to the UK. She continued expanding her experience by joining several community groups and is Chair of Resident Tenants Associacion in a wide Afro-Caribbean area in south London, Vice-Chair to the Lilford Estate Women’s Action Group, as well as being a member of Committee of Latin American Studies Group, plus other institutions related to the service and welfare of the Latin American community in the UK.
